Assistance to families of 'tribal martyrs'
Source: The Sangai Express
Kangpokpi, September 05 2015 :
Kukis of Nagaland have extended monetary assistance of Rs 35,000 to the families of 'tribal martyrs' who were killed by security forces during a protest against three Bills passed by the State Assembly.
The amount was handed to KSO Ghqs today.
At the same time, HYA Ghqs has donated Rs 20,000 for treatment of injured victims in Imphal today.
General secretary of KSO Ghqs Seiboi Haokip today expressed gratitude to all generous donors, saying such show of solidarity would strengthen the bond of unity among the tribals.
Meanwhile, Kuki Inpi Assam (KIA) has strongly opposed the passing of three Bills by the Manipur Assembly on Aug 31 .
KIA also condemned the high-handedness of the Manipur police against the tribal protesters which led to the death of eight tribal youth including a minor.
It demanded a CBI probe into the killings.
Urging the Manipur CM to clear all apprehensions regarding the Bills by withdrawing them, the KIA said the Bills were in contravention of the provisions of United Nations Declaration on Rights of the Indigenous Peoples (UNDRIP) .
